An analysis of local energy and phase congruency models in visual feature detection

A variety of approaches have been developed for the detection of features such as edges, lines, and corners in images. Many techniques presuppose the feature type, such as a step edge, and use the differential properties of the luminance function to detect the location of such features. The local energy model provides an alternative approach, detecting a variety of feature types in a single pass by analysing order in the phase components of the Fourier transform of the image. The local energy model is usually implemented by calculating the envelope of the analytic signal associated with the image function. Here we analyse the accuracy of such an implementation, and show that in certain cases the feature location is only approximately given by the local energy model. Orientation selectivity is another aspect of the local energy model, and we show that a feature is only correctly located at a peak of the local energy function when local energy has a zero gradient in two orthogonal directions at the peak point.

[1]  John F. Canny,et al.  A Computational Approach to Edge Detection , 1986,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[2]  Robyn A. Owens,et al.  Image Compression and Reconstruction Using a 1-D Feature Catalogue , 1992, ECCV.

[3]  John Ross,et al.  Learning features in natural images , 1993 .

[4]  Robyn A. Owens,et al.  Feature-free images , 1994, Pattern Recognit. Lett..

[5]  D Marr,et al.  Theory of edge detection , 1979, Proceedings of the Royal Society of London. Series B. Biological Sciences.

[6]  Robyn A. Owens,et al.  A Catalog of 1-D Features in Natural Images , 1994, CVGIP Graph. Model. Image Process..

[7]  Robert M. Haralick,et al.  Digital Step Edges from Zero Crossing of Second Directional Derivatives , 1984,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[8]  R. Haralick Edge and region analysis for digital image data , 1980 .

[9]  A.V. Oppenheim,et al.  The importance of phase in signals , 1980, Proceedings of the IEEE.

[10]  Robyn A. Owens,et al.  Feature detection from local energy , 1987, Pattern Recognit. Lett..

[11]  Svetha Venkatesh,et al.  Edge detection is a projection , 1989, Pattern Recognit. Lett..

[12]  David Malah,et al.  A study of edge detection algorithms , 1982, Comput. Graph. Image Process..

[13]  J. Alison Noble,et al.  Morphological Feature Detection , 1988, [1988 Proceedings] Second International Conference on Computer Vision.

[14]  D. Burr,et al.  Mach bands are phase dependent , 1986, Nature.

[15]  P. Kovesi A Dimensionless Measure of Edge Significance From Phase Congruency Calculated Via Wavelets , 1993 .

[16]  Svetha Venkatesh,et al.  On the classification of image features , 1990, Pattern Recognit. Lett..

[17]  Robyn Owens,et al.  The 2D Local Energy Model , 1994 .

[18]  D. Burr,et al.  Feature detection in human vision: a phase-dependent energy model , 1988, Proceedings of the Royal Society of London. Series B. Biological Sciences.